The Sunni group is the largest branch of Islam, comprising about 85-90% of the Muslim population worldwide, while Shia Muslims make up about 10-15%. Therefore, the correct answer is Sunni.

Abraham is considered the founder of Judaism as he is recognized as the first patriarch and a key figure in the covenant between God and the Jewish people, establishing the faith's foundational beliefs.

Judaism is considered the oldest of the three major monotheistic religions, with roots tracing back over 3,000 years, while Christianity and Islam emerged later, around 2,000 and 1,400 years ago, respectively.
